# G♭11 Guitar Chord

> The G♭11 dominant 11 chord extends the dominant 9th by adding an 11th C♭, creating a layered, suspended sound. This harmonic richness enhances jazz and fusion progressions, generating a mystical, unresolved atmosphere. With D♭ in the bass, this voicing functions as the 2nd inversion of G♭11.

Source: https://guitarwiz.app/chords/g-flat11/d-flat

## Chord Facts

- Symbol: G♭11
- Notes: G♭, B♭, D♭, F♭, A♭, C♭
- Intervals: 1 (G♭), 3 (B♭), 5 (D♭), ♭7 (F♭), 9 (A♭), 11 (C♭)
- Mood: open, expansive, atmospheric, airy
- Genres: Jazz, Fusion, Progressive Rock
